x86: consolidate VPCLMUL tests
authorJan Beulich <jbeulich@suse.com>
Mon, 24 Oct 2022 07:34:23 +0000 (09:34 +0200)
committerJan Beulich <jbeulich@suse.com>
Mon, 24 Oct 2022 07:34:23 +0000 (09:34 +0200)
commit05bb930a054c80b6f8aecd93dafbcb464a403bc5
treeb2101ca7d4ecbedf8fa30e3fcad3e450def146a0
parenta87cd57616852e661d04fcb0a061f6e5b34b63d4
x86: consolidate VPCLMUL tests

There's little point in having Intel syntax disassembler tests when the
purpose of a test is assembler functionality: Drop all
*avx512*_vpclmulqdq-wig1-intel.

For *avx512*_vpclmulqdq-wig1 share source with *avx512*_vpclmulqdq.

Finally put in place similar tests for -mvexwig=1.
15 files changed:
gas/testsuite/gas/i386/avx512f_vpclmulqdq-wig.s [deleted file]
gas/testsuite/gas/i386/avx512f_vpclmulqdq-wig1-intel.d [deleted file]
gas/testsuite/gas/i386/avx512f_vpclmulqdq-wig1.d
gas/testsuite/gas/i386/avx512vl_vpclmulqdq-wig.s [deleted file]
gas/testsuite/gas/i386/avx512vl_vpclmulqdq-wig1-intel.d [deleted file]
gas/testsuite/gas/i386/avx512vl_vpclmulqdq-wig1.d
gas/testsuite/gas/i386/i386.exp
gas/testsuite/gas/i386/vpclmulqdq-wig1.d [new file with mode: 0644]
gas/testsuite/gas/i386/x86-64-avx512f_vpclmulqdq-wig.s [deleted file]
gas/testsuite/gas/i386/x86-64-avx512f_vpclmulqdq-wig1-intel.d [deleted file]
gas/testsuite/gas/i386/x86-64-avx512f_vpclmulqdq-wig1.d
gas/testsuite/gas/i386/x86-64-avx512vl_vpclmulqdq-wig.s [deleted file]
gas/testsuite/gas/i386/x86-64-avx512vl_vpclmulqdq-wig1-intel.d [deleted file]
gas/testsuite/gas/i386/x86-64-avx512vl_vpclmulqdq-wig1.d
gas/testsuite/gas/i386/x86-64-vpclmulqdq-wig1.d [new file with mode: 0644]